Q1. The energy of the nth orbit of hydrogen atom is given by En = -13.6 / n² eV. The energy of the 2nd orbit is
Answer: -3.4 eV
Explanation: Using En = -13.6 / n², for n = 2, En = -13.6 / 2² = -3.4 eV.
